折衍混合型三焦点人工晶状体常数优化的临床研究

Optimization of intraocular lens constant of a hybrid intraocular lens

:845-856
 
目的:比较Alcon Acrysof IQ PanOptix TFNT00 (PanOptix)晶状体常数优化前后对人工晶状体(intraocular lens,IOL)度数计算准确性的影响,以及不同眼轴长度晶状体常数优化的效果。方法:回顾性收集2021年6月—2022年3月在上海爱尔眼科医院行白内障超声乳化手术联合植入PanOptix IOL患者的术前眼球生物学测量参数、植入IOL度数和术后1~3个月的显然验光结果。联合SRK/T、Hoffer Q、Holladay 1、Haigis公式,通过回归法计算优化的晶状体常数A、pACD、SF,通过多元线性回归计算优化的晶状体常数a0、a1和a2。观察晶状体常数优化前后平均绝对预测误差值(mean absolute error,MAE)及中位绝对预测误差值(median absolute error,MedAE),预测误差在±0.25、±0.50、±0.75、±1.00 D以内的百分比的差异,评价晶状体常数优化对IOL计算准确性的影响。随后,按照眼轴长度进行分组(非高度近视组:<26.00 mm; 高度近视组:≥26.00 mm),比较非高度近视组和高度近视组优化晶状体常数的差异。结果共92眼(54位患者)纳入研究。优化前的晶状体常数A、pACD、SF、a0、a1和a2分别为119.1、5.63、1.83、1.39、0.40和0.10;优化后分别为119.35、6.14、2.36、?3.42,0.12和0.34。在全部眼轴组,晶状体常数优化前,SRK/T、Hoffer Q、Holladay 1、Haigis公式的MAE值分别为0.44、0.50、0.54、0.46 D;优化后,MAE值分别为0.43、0.54、0.51、0.35 D,其中Haigis公式优化前后比较差异有统计学意义(P=0.001)。在非高度近视组,晶状体常数优化前,4条公式的MAE值分别为0.46、0.40、0.40、0.42 D;优化后,MAE值分别为0.46 D、0.38 D、0.39 D、0.38 D,比较差异均无统计学意义(均P>0.05)。在高度近视组,晶状体常数优化前,4条公式的MAE值分别为0.42、0.59、0.66、0.50 D;优化后,MAE值分别为0.36、0.48、0.47、0.31 D,其中Holladay 1和Haigis公式优化前后比较差异有统计学意义(P 分别为 0.020、0.002)。结论PanOptix IOL的晶状体常数优化可以提高IOL度数计算的准确性,在高度近视组中比非高度近视组中优化意义更大。
Objective: To assess the benefits of intraocular lens (IOL) constant optimization of Alcon Acrysof IQ PanOptix TFNT00 (PanOptix) on the accuracy of IOL power calculation, and the effects of constant optimization between different axial length (AL) groups were further compared. Methods: Patients who underwent phacoemulsification and implantation with PanOptix IOL between June, 2021 and March, 2022 were included in this retrospective study. The preoperative biological ocular parameters, implanted IOL power, and subjective 1-3 months postoperative refraction were collected. Combined with SRK/T, Hoffer Q, Holladay 1 and Haigis formulas, the optimized IOL constant A, surgeon factor (SF), post-surgery anterior chamber depth (pACD), and a0, a1, a2 were back-calculated. Refractive outcomes using optimized IOL constants were re-calculated combined with the corresponding formulas. Compare the mean absolute error (MAE), medium absolute error (MedAE) and percentage of eyes with IOL prediction errors (PE) within ±0.25, ±0.50, ±0.75 and ±1.00 (diopter)D when using the optimized constants and the manufacture constants. Patients were divided into two groups according to AL (non-high myopia: <26.0 mm; high myopia: ≥26 mm), compare the difference of IOL constant optimization between AL subgroups. Results: A total of 92 eyes of 54 patients were enrolled. The manufacture lens constant of A, pACD, SF, a0, a1 and a2 are respectively 119.1, 5.63, 1.83, 1.39, 0.4 and 0.1; and the optimized values are respectively 119.35, 6.14, 2.36, ?3.42, 0.12 and 0.34. In all patients group, with manufacture lens constant, the MAE values of SRKT, Hoffer Q, Holladay 1 and Haigis formula are 0.44, 0.50, 0.54, 0.46 D; with optimized lens constants, the MAE values are 0.43, 0.54, 0.51, 0.35 D, and there is a statistical difference of Haigis formula after optimization (P=0.001). In non-high myopia group, with manufacture lens constant, the MAE values are 0.46, 0.40, 0.40, 0.42 D; with optimized lens constants, the MAE values are0.46, 0.38, 0.39, 0.38 D, and no statistical difference has been found(P>0.05). In high myopia group, with manufacture lens constant, the MAE values are 0.42, 0.59, 0.66, 0.50 D; with optimized lens constants, the MAE values are 0.36, 0.48, 0.47, 0.31 D, and there are statistical differences of Holladay 1 and Haigis formula after optimization (P = 0.020, 0.002). Conclusion: IOL constant optimization of PanOptix IOL can improve the accuracy of IOL calculation, which is more significant in the high myopia group.

改良的“Z”形无线结经巩膜缝线固定后房型人工晶状体手术治疗先天性晶状体脱位的临床疗效评价

Clinical evaluation of modified "Z"-shaped knotless transscleral suture fixation posterior chamber intraocular lens surgery for Congenital ectopia lentis

:83-91
 
目的:通过对改良“Z”形无线结经巩膜缝线固定人工晶状体手术和传统有线结巩膜缝线固定人工晶状体手术治疗先天性晶状体脱位的比较来评价改良术式的临床疗效。方法:回顾性病例研究。纳入2018年1月—2021年3月期间于中山大学中山眼科中心行手术治疗的先天性晶状体脱位患者73例73眼,按手术方式不同将患者分为无线结组36例36眼和有线结组37例37眼。比较两组患者术前和术后1年的球镜度(DS)、柱镜度(DC)、等效球镜(SE)、最佳矫正视力(BCVA)、眼压(IOP)、眼轴长度(AL)、角膜内皮细胞计数和术后并发症的发生率。结果:两组患者术前各项观察指标组间比较差异无统计学意义(均P>0.05)。两组患者术后1年 BCVA 均较术前提高(均P<0.05),SE均较术前降低(均P<0.05)。两组患者术后1年 BCVA 、DS、DC、SE、IOP、AL、角膜内皮细胞丢失率组间比较差异均无统计学意义(均P>0.05)。术后1年,有线结组有5例(13.5%)出现缝线暴露,无线结组未出现缝线暴露,组间比较差异有统计学意义(P<0.05)。结论:改良无线结 IOL 巩膜缝线固定手术可改善CEL患者的最佳矫正视力和屈光不正,有效减少缝线暴露及相关并发症。
Objective: To evaluate the clinical efficacy of modified “Z”-shaped knotless transscleral suture fixation intraocular lens (IOL) and traditional knotted transscleral suture fixation IOL in congenital ectopia lentis. Methods: A retrospective case study. A total of 73 eyes of 73 patients with congenital ectopia lentis who underwent surgical treatment in our hospital from January 2018 to March 2021 were included. According to different surgical methods, the patients were divided into the knotless group (36 eyes) and knotted group (37 eyes). Preoperative and postoperative of 1-year diopter sphere (DS), diopter cylinder (DC), spherical equivalent (SE), best corrected visual acuity (BCVA), intraocular pressure (IOP), and axial length (AL), corneal endothelial cell counts and the occurrence of postoperative complications rate were analyzed among two groups. Results: There was no significant difference in preoperative outcome measures between the two groups (P>0.05). BCVA at 1-year postoperative was significantly better (P<0.05), and SE at 1-year postoperative was significantly lower (P<0.05). There was no significant difference in BCVA, DS, DC, SE, IOP, AL, and corneal endothelial cell loss rate between the two groups at 1-year after operation (P>0.05). One year after the operation, there were 5 cases of suture exposure (13.5%) in the knotted group and no suture exposure in the knotless group, and the difference was statistically significant (P<0.05). Conclusions: The modified knotless IOL transscleral suture fixation can improve the best corrected visual acuity and alleviate ametropia of CEL patients, and reduce suture exposure and related complications effectively.

基于 OA-2000 测量的硅油取出联合白内障手术患者人工晶状体计算公式预测准确性分析

Prediction accuracy analysis of intraocular lens calculation formulas in patients undergoing silicone oil removal combined with cataract surgery based on OA-2000 measurement

:857-866
 
目的:在硅油取出联合白内障手术患者中,使用扫频源光学相干断层扫描生物测量仪OA-2000进行生物测量,比较10种人工晶状体(IOL)屈光力计算公式的准确性。方法:回顾性分析2021年3月—7月于中山大学中山眼科中心接受硅油取出联合白内障手术的患者共62例(62眼),所有患者均使用扫频源光学相干断层扫描生物测量仪OA-2000进行生物学参数测量。计算并比较新公式[Barrett Universal II (BUII)、Emmetropia Verifying Optical(EVO) 2.0、Hill-Radial Basis Function (Hill-RBF) 3.0、Hoffer QST、Kane、Pearl-DGS]及传统公式(Haigis、Hoffer Q、Holladay 1、SRK/T)的预测准确性,主要评价指标为绝对预测误差中位数(MedAE)及平均绝对预测误差(MAE)。按眼轴长度≤23 mm(组1),>23 mm且≤26 mm(组2)与>26 mm(组3)进行亚组分析。结果:6个新公式、Haigis、SRK/T公式均出现近视漂移(-0.47 ~-0.27 D,P<0.05),而HofferQ及Holladay 1公式无系统误差(P>0.05)。Kane公式的MedAE(0.55 D)及MAE(0.81 D)最小,但公式间比较差异无统计学意义(P>0.05)。组1中所有公式均出现近视漂移(-1.46~ -1.25 D,P<0.05),而其他亚组比较差异无统计学意义(-0.32 ~ 0.41 D,P>0.05)。在组1中,Pearl-DGS公式的MedAE(0.97 D)及MAE(1.26 D)最小,且优于Hill-RBF 3.0(P=0.01)及SRK/T公式(P=0.02);组2中,Kane公式具有最小的MedAE(0.44 D)及MAE(0.66 D);组3各个公式屈光预测准确性比较差异无统计学意义(P>0.05)。结论:在使用OA-2000进行术前生物测量时,Kane公式在接受硅油取出联合白内障手术患者中的预测准确性较高;而眼轴长度≤23 mm时,Pearl-DGS公式可能更为准确。
Objective: To compare the accuracy of 10 intraocular lens (IOL) power calculation formulas in patients undergoing combined silicone oil removal and cataract surgery, biometry is performed using the swept-source optical coherence tomography biometer OA-2000. Methods: A retrospective analysis. A total of 62 patients (62 eyes) who underwent combined silicone oil removal and cataract surgery in Zhongshan Ophthalmic Center, Sun Yat-sen University from March to July in 2021 were enrolled. Preoperative biometry was performed by OA-2000 in all patients. New-generation formulas (Barrett Universal II [BUII], Emmetropia Verifying Optical [EVO] 2.0, Hill-Radial Basis Function [Hill-RBF] 3.0, Hoffer QST, Kane and Pearl-DGS) and traditional formulas (Haigis, Hoffer Q, Holladay 1 and SRK/T) were evaluated. The median absolute prediction error (MedAE) and mean absolute prediction error (MAE) were the main parameters used to assess accuracy. Subgroup analyses were performed based on the axial length of 23 mm and 26 mm. Results: Six new-generation formulas, Haigis, and SRK/T showed myopic shift (-0.47 ~ -0.27 D, P<0.05), while no systematic bias was found in Hoffer Q and Holladay 1 displayed (P>0.05). The smallest MedAE (0.55 D) and MAE (0.81 D) were found in Kane formula, but there was no statistically significant difference compared with other formulas (P>0.05). The myopic shift (-1.46 ~ -1.25 D, P<0.05) in eyes shorter than 23 mm were found in all formulas, while there was no significant systematic bias (-0.32 ~ 0.41 D, P>0.05) in other subgroups. In axial length shorter than 23 mm, the Pearl-DGS formula stated the smallest MedAE (0.97 D) and MAE (1.26 D), and was significantly more accurate than Hill-RBF 3.0 (P=0.01) and SRK/T (P=0.02). In eyes with an axial length between 23 mm and 26 mm, the Kane formula had the lowest MedAE (0.44 D) and MAE (0.66 D). No significant difference was found in eyes longer than 26 mm. Conclusion: The Kane formula showed the highest accuracy in patients undergoing combined silicone oil removal and cataract surgery measured by OA-2000, whereas the Pearl-DGS formula could be more accurate in eyes with an axial length shorter than 23 mm.

囊袋上经巩膜缝线固定IOL植入术治疗球形晶状体的有效性和安全性研究

The efficacy and safety of the application of phacoemulsification combined with supra-capsular and scleral-fixated intraocular lens implantation in microspherophakia surgery

:92-100
 
目的:探讨超声乳化晶状体吸除联合囊袋上经巩膜缝线固定人工晶状体(intraocular lens,IOL)植入术治疗球形晶状体(microspherophakia,MSP)的有效性和安全性。方法:采用回顾性分析,选取2019年1月至 2020年6月期间在复旦大学附属眼耳鼻喉科医院进行治疗的MSP患者37例(37眼),随机分为两组,纳入行超声乳化晶状体吸除联合囊袋上巩膜缝线固定IOL植入术(supra-capsular and scleral-fixated intraocular lens implantation,SCSF-IOL)的MSP患者20例(20眼)和行超声乳化晶状体吸除联合改良型囊袋张力环植入术(transscleral-fixated modified capsular tension ring and in-the-bag intraocular lens implantation,MCTR-IOL)的MSP患者17例(17眼),观察两组术后最佳矫正视力及并发症等情况。结果:两组术后最佳矫正视力比术前均有改善(P<0.001),而组间比较差异无统计学意义(P=0.326)。两组的IOL倾斜度相当(P=0.216)。预防性Nd:YAG激光后囊膜切开术在SCSFIOL术后1周至1个月进行。在SCSF-IOL组,2眼(10.00%)需要重复激光治疗,1眼(5.00%)出现囊口偏心。后囊膜混浊是MCTR组最常见并发症(6眼,35.29%)。随访期间两组均未出现IOL脱位、继发性青光眼和视网膜脱离。结论:SCSF-IOL是治疗球形晶状体的简单易行的手术方式,疗效与MCTR-IOL相当。Nd:YAG激光后囊膜切开术是预防SCSF-IOL术后囊袋并发症的必要手段。
Objective: To investigate the efficacy and safety of phacoemulsification combined with supra-capsular and scleral-fixated intraocular lens (IOL) implantation in the treatment of microspherophakia (MSP). Methods: by retrospective analysis, 37 MSP patients (37 eyes) who were treated in our hospital from January 2019 to June 2020 were randomly divided into two groups, including 20 MSP patients (20 eyes) who treated by SCSF-IOL and 17 MSP patients (17 eyes) who treated by transscleral-fixated modified capsular tension ring and in-the-bag intraocular lens implantation (MCTR-IOL). The best corrected vision and complications were observed. Results: the best corrected vision was significantly improved in both groups (P < 0.001), but there was no remarkable difference between the two groups (P = 0.326). The IOL tilt was also comparable (P = 0.216). Prophylactic Nd: YAG laser posterior capsulotomy was performed from 1 week to 1 month after the SCSF-IOL procedure. In the SCSF-IOL group, two eyes (10.00%) needed repeated laser treatment, and one eye (5.00%) had a decentered capsule opening. Posterior capsular opacification was the most common complication (6, 35.29%) in the MCTR group. No IOL dislocation, secondary glaucoma, or retinal detachment was observed during follow-up. Conclusions: SCSF-IOL is a simple and viable surgical option for managing MSP and is comparable with the MCTR-IOL. Nd: YAG laser posterior capsulotomy is a necessary mean to prevent residual capsule complications after the SCSF-IOL procedure.

双眼白内障术后单眼人工晶状体混浊一例

One eye intraocular lens opacity after bilateral cataract surgery:a case report

:580-586
 
人工晶状体混浊是白内障术后较为少见的并发症,患者多于手术后数月或数年因不明原因视力下降或视朦就诊。本文报道一例73岁女性患者,在同一时期双眼先后植入同一型号亲水性丙烯酸酯人工晶状体,术后6年右眼人工晶状体完全混浊,而左眼人工晶状体仍为完全透明状态。两眼的临床眼部体征、眼前节光学相干断层成像(optic coherence tomography,OCT)、超声生物显微镜检查(ultrasound biomicroscopy,UBM)等检查结果均有明显差异,人工晶状体混浊眼通过手术治疗后视力恢复满意。文章详细记录了该例患者术前的相关资料、手术治疗以及手术取出人工晶状体的检查结果,并进行了分析讨论,供专家同行参阅,为该类患者的诊疗提供参考。
Intraocular lens opacity is a relatively rare complication after cataract surgery. Many patients seek medical service serveral months or years after surgery, due to unexplained visual impairment or blurred vision. A case is reported in this article that a 73-year-old female patient who was implanted the same type of hydrophilic acrylate intraocular lens in both eyes during the same period. After 6 years of surgery, the right intraocular lens was completely cloudy, while the left intraocular lens remained completely transparent. Significant differences were found in two eyes clinical symptoms,optical coherence tomography (OCT), and ultrasound biomicroscopy (UBM) examination results. After surgical treatment, the vision of eye with intraocular lens opacity has recovered satisfactorily. In the article, the detailed record of  the patient's preoperative relevant information, surgical treatment, and examination results of removing the intraocular lens were stated. The analysis and discussion results were also indicated to provide reference on the diagnosis and treatment of this type of patient for experts and colleagues.

多焦点人工晶状体2.2 mm微切口植入治疗老年性白内障的临床观察

Clinical observation of multifocal intraocular lens with 2.2 mm microincision implantation for senile cataract

:229-236
 
目的:评估2.2 mm微切口白内障超声乳化摘除(phacoemulsification,Phaco)联合多焦点人工晶状体(multifocal intraocular lens,MIOLs)植入术治疗老年性白内障的临床安全性及疗效。方法:选取于2018年1月1日至2018年6月31日于佛山市第二人民医院行白内障Phaco联合人工晶状体植入的老年白内障患者。将其分为2组:A组31例35眼行2.2 mm微切口Phaco联合MIOLs植入术,B组31例38眼行3.0 mm标准切口Phaco联合单焦点IOLs植入术。2组患者均完善术前、术后的裸眼视力、角膜曲率、眼压、角膜内皮细胞数、离焦曲线等检查,同时记录其手术过程中的参数,进行比较。结果:A组与B组在手术过程中,总超乳时间、总超乳能量、超声乳化累积能量复合参数、有效超乳时间、平均超乳能量、总手术时间对比,差异均无统计学意义(均P>0.05)。2组患者术后较术前比较,角膜内皮细胞数均有所下降,差异有统计学意义(P<0.05);2组患者间在各时间点的比较,差异均无统计学意义(均P>0.05)。2组患者手术中均未出现后囊膜破裂等并发症。2.2 mm切口与3.0 mm切口术后均增加了角膜散光,与术前比较差异均有统计学意义(均P<0.01);2组间比较,差异无统计学意义(均P>0.05)。术后3个月,2组间裸眼远视力(uncorrected distance visual acuity,UCDVA)对比差异无统计学意义(t=?1.794,P=0.07);裸眼近视力(uncorrected near visual acuity,UCNVA)对比差异有统计学意义(t=?25.147,P<0.01)。A组的离焦曲线有2个峰值,分别位于0 D和?3.5 D附近,两峰值间形成一个下降平缓的平台;B组的离焦曲线只有1个峰值,位于0~0.5 D之间,峰值两端下降趋势明显。A组的脱镜率为77.42%(24/31),B组的脱镜率为12.90%(4/31),差异有统计学意义(χ2 =26.050,P<0.01);2组的总体满意度差异无统计学意义(χ2 =1.615,P=0.204)。结论:2.2 mm同轴微切口白内障手术在临床上安全性良好,联合植入MIOLs有较好的疗效,可于临床上广泛推广。
Objective: To evaluate the clinical safety and curative effect of phacoemulsification (Phaco) combined with multifocal intraocular lens (MIOLs) implantation in the treatment of senile cataract with 2.2 mm microincision cataract. Methods: The cataract patients who underwent phacoemulsification and intraocular lens implantation in our hospital were selected from January 1, 2018 to June 31, 2018. They were divided into two groups: group A with 31 patients (35 eyes) undergoing 2.2 mm micro-incision Phaco combined with MIOLs, while group B with 31 patients (38 eyes) undergoing 3.0 mm standard incision Phaco combined with single focus IOLs.The preoperative and postoperative uncorrected visual acuity, corneal curvature, intraocular pressure, corneal endothelium number, and defocus curve were recorded in both groups. The parameters during the operation were also recorded and compared. Results: There was no statistically significant difference in the parameters including total phacoemulsification time, total phacoemulsification energy, phacoemulsification cumulative energy compound parameters, effective phacoemulsification time, average phacoemulsification energy, total surgery time between group A and group B during the operation (all P>0.05). Compared with preoperative, the number of corneal endothelial cells decreased both in the two groups after surgery. The difference was statistically significant (P<0.05). There was no significant difference between the two groups at any time (all P>0.05). There were no complications such as posterior capsule rupture during operation in both groups. The corneal astigmatism was increased after operation both in the 2.2 mm incision and 3.0 mm incision, and the difference was statistically significant compared with pre-operation (both P<0.01). There was no significant difference between the two groups (all P>0.05). At 3 months postoperatively, there was no significant difference in uncorrected distance visual acuity (UCDVA) between the two groups (t=?1.794, P=0.07), and the difference was statistically significant in the uncorrected near visual acuity (UCNVA) (t=?25.147, P<0.01). Defocus curve: The defocus curve of group A had two peaks, which are located near 0 D and ?3.5 D, forming a flat platform with a descent between the two peaks.The defocus curve of group B had only one peak, located at 0–0.5 D, and the downward trend at both ends of the peak was obvious. The rate of off-glasses and satisfaction: the rate of off-glasses in group A was 77.42% (24/31),and the rate of dislocation in group B was 12.90% (4/31). The difference was statistically significant (χ2 =26.050,P<0.01). There was no significant difference in overall satisfaction between the two groups (χ2 =1.615, P=0.204).Conclusion: The 2.2 mm coaxial microincision cataract surgery yields high clinical safety, and the combined implantation of multi-focal intraocular lens has good curative effect and can be widely promoted in clinical practice.

正确认识眼内淋巴瘤分子病理检查结果

Correctly understanding the molecular pathological findings of intraocular lymphoma

:684-687
 
近年来日益强大的眼内液分子/细胞生物学检测技术因其简便、快捷和高效的特点,使得眼科医生在诊断眼内淋巴瘤时倾向于单纯只依据此类方法而淡化病理诊断的重要性。眼内液分子/细胞生物学技术因其本身只能“间接提示肿瘤细胞存在”的局限性而不能作为眼内淋巴瘤的确诊依据。眼内组织/细胞病理仍然是眼内淋巴瘤诊断的金标准,其价值和地位不能被其他任何分子/细胞生物学检测手段所替代。理解并掌握各种诊断、检测技术的优势和局限性,规范和优化眼内组织/细胞病理标本的采集、保存和送检流程有助于提高眼科临床医生对眼内淋巴瘤的诊断效率和医疗质量。
In recent years, more and more powerful molecular/cellular biological techniques of intraocular fluid have made ophthalmologists tend to only rely on these methods in the diagnosis of intraocular lymphoma because of their features of simplicity, fastness and efficiency. The molecular/cellular biological techniques of intraocular fluid cannot be used as the basis for the diagnosis of intraocular lymphoma because it can only indicate the existence of tumor cells indirectly. Intraocular tissue/cell pathology remains the gold standard for the diagnosis of intraocular lymphoma, and its importance cannot be replaced by any other molecular/cell biological methods. Understanding and mastering the advantages and limitations of various diagnostic techniques, standardizing and optimizing the collection, preservation and submission process of intraocular tissue/cell specimens will help ophthalmologists improve the diagnostic efficiency and medical quality of intraocular lymphoma.

需加强对眼内淋巴瘤的重视

Attention should be paid to intraocular lymphoma

:669-675
 
眼内淋巴瘤(intraocular lymphoma,IOL)比较罕见。按起源位置分为两种类型,主要类型为原发性眼内淋巴瘤(primary intraocular lymphoma,PIOL),也称为原发性中枢神经系统淋巴瘤(primary central nervous system lymphoma,PCNSL);另外一种类型为继发性眼内淋巴瘤(secondary intraocular lymphoma,SIOL),为中枢神经系统以外的淋巴瘤转移至眼内。按肿瘤类型主要分为三类,主要类型为眼内弥漫大B细胞淋巴瘤,属于高级别淋巴瘤,预后较差;其次为少见的主要侵犯脉络膜的黏膜相关淋巴组织结外边缘区B细胞淋巴瘤,属于低级别淋巴瘤,预后较好;第三种类型为极少见的眼内NK/T细胞淋巴瘤,属于高级别淋巴瘤,预后极差。该病的诊断对眼科医生和病理医生都极具挑战性。实验室检测方法主要包括病理学、免疫细胞化学、流式细胞术、细胞因子及基因重排等,但眼内病理活检仍然是该病诊断的金标准。该病的治疗主要为眼内局部化疗、放射治疗及系统性化疗。IOL早期常因误诊而耽误治疗,目前该病明确诊断时多在患者出现症状后4~40个月,多数病例早期被误诊为葡萄膜炎而失去治疗的最佳时机,导致预后较差。因此应充分认识IOL的早期表现,早期诊断、早期治疗,从而大大提高疗效。
Intraocular lymphomas (IOL) are rare malignant neoplasms including primary intraocular lymphoma (PIOL) and secondary intraocular lymphoma (SIOL). The former is also known as primary central nervous system lymphoma(PCNSL). The latter is a kind of lymphoma metastasizing to the eye from outside the central nervous system. IOL can further be divided into three different types. The most common type is vitreoretinal high-grade diffuse large B-cell lymphoma with poor prognosis. The less common type is primary choroidal extranodal marginal zone B-cell lymphoma of mucosa associated lymphoid tissue, which is low-grade B-cell lymphoma with better prognosis.The rare type is NK/T cell lymphomas with very poor prognosis. The diagnosis of this disease is challenging for both ophthalmologists and pathologists. Laboratory testing methods mainly include cytology/pathology,immunocytochemistry, flow cytometry, cytokine analysis and gene rearrangement detection. The detection of malignant lymphoid cells cytologically/pathologically is still the gold standard for diagnosing IOL. The treatment involves local chemotherapy, radiotherapy and systemic chemotherapy. Most intraocular lymphomas at early stage are misdiagnosed as uveitis and proper treatment is often delayed with poor diagnosis due to the lost of best time for treatment. So far, the delay between the diagnosis and the onset of ocular symptoms ranges from 4 to 40 months. Therefore, we should fully understand the early manifestations of intraocular lymphoma and early diagnose and timely treat the disease in order to improve prognosis.

细胞块制备试剂盒在眼内玻璃体液细胞学检查中的应用

Application of cell block preparation kit in cytological examination of intraocular vitreous humor

:585-589
 
目的:探索用细胞块制备试剂盒对眼内玻璃体液微量细胞制备细胞块的成功率,苏木素-伊红(hematoxylin-eosin,HE)染色效果及技术要点。方法:收集中山大学中山眼科中心临床病理科2020年9月至2021年1月由临床送检的25例玻璃体液(含玻璃体切割液),应用细胞块制备试剂盒制备细胞块后,常规固定、脱水、包埋、切片,随后进行HE染色,观察染色效果。结果:25例玻璃体细胞蜡块制作成功率达到100%,制片后HE染色效果好,背景干净,细胞形态清晰,核质对比分明。结论:应用细胞块制备试剂盒能将眼内玻璃体液微量细胞制成蜡块,极大提高了标本的利用率,为后续的病理研究提供丰富的材料。
Objective: To explore the effect and technical key points of the cell block preparation kit for collecting a few cells in ocular vitreous humor. Methods: A total of 25 cases of vitreous humor (including vitrectomy fluid) were collected from Zhongshan Ophthalmic Center, Sun Yat-sen University from September 2020 to January 2021.Cell block preparation kit was used to prepare cell blocks, which were routinely fixed, dehydrated, embedded,sectioned, and then hematoxylin-eosin (HE) stained. Results: The success rate of 25 cases of vitreous cell paraffinblocks reached 100%, and the morphology of the cells was clear with clean background and shape contrast of nucleus and plasma in HE staining. Conclusion: The cell block preparation kit can make the cells of intraocular vitreous humor into paraffin blocks, which greatly improves the utilization rate of specimens and is conducive to providing abundant materials for pathological studies.

硅油填充术后眼压对角膜内皮细胞的影响及变化特点

Effect of intraocular pressure on corneal endothelial cells after silicone oil tamponade

:495-502
 
目的:评估硅油填充术后眼压对角膜内皮细胞的影响及变化特点。方法:选取2019年1月1日至9月30日在佛山市第二人民医院眼科中心行玻璃体切除联合硅油注射的患者共131名,分为高眼压组(n=80)和正常眼压组(n=51)。高眼压组术后任意一次测眼压>21 mmHg,正常眼压组术后眼压均≤21 mmHg。比较填充硅油前与取硅油时的角膜内皮细胞参数测量值。结果:高眼压组的平均眼压为20.79 mmHg,正常眼压组的平均眼压为14.70 mmHg(P<0.001)。取硅油时,两组角膜内皮细胞密度(corneal endothelial cell density,ECD)均明显减少,平均内皮细胞面积均明显增大(P<0.05),高眼压组内皮细胞大小变异系数(coefficient of variation of endothelial cell size,CV)明显变大(P<0.05)。高眼压组ECD丢失率(6.3%)高于正常眼压组(3.5%);其中,高眼压组中术后1~6周内的眼压升高(7.1%)、眼压≥40 mmHg(7.3%)对角膜内皮细胞影响最大。ECD丢失与眼压变化有显著相关性(r=0.176,P=0.044)。结论:硅油填充后高眼压是角膜内皮细胞丢失的重要危险因素。
Objective: To evaluate the effect of intraocular pressure (IOP) on corneal endothelial cells after silicone oil tamponade. Methods: Patients (n=131) received vitrectomy with silicone oil injection in Ophthalmology Center in Second People’s Hospital of Foshan City from January 1st to September 30th 2019 were divided into the high IOP group (n=80) and normal IOP group (n=51). IOP was >21 mmHg at any time in the high IOP group and was ≤21mmHg in the normal IOP group after surgery. The values of corneal endothelial cells before filling with silicone oil and before removing silicone oil were compared.Results: The average IOP was 20.79 mmHg in the high IOP group, and 14.70 mmHg in the normal IOP group (P<0.001). The number of endothelial cells (ECD) was reduced, but the average endothelial cell area was increased (P<0.05) in both groups. The coefficient of variation of endothelial cell size in high IOP group was increased (P<0.05). ECD loss rate was 6.3% in the high IOP group and 3.5% in normal IOP group. Increased IOP within 1–6 weeks after surgery (7.1%) and IOP ≥40 mmHg (7.3%) had the greatest impact on ECD. ECD loss was correlated with IOP (r=0.176, P=0.044).
